Description

Part I: Sailing the '3Cs': Chromosome Conformation Capture and Its Variants

1. Quantitative Chromosome Conformation Capture (3C-qPCR)

Cosette Rebouissou, Séphora Sallis, and Thierry Forné

2. Detection of Allele-Specific 3D Chromatin Interactions Using High-Resolution In-Nucleus 4C-Seq

Mélanie Miranda, Daan Noordermeer, and Benoit Moindrot

3. Tough Tissue Hi-C

Stefan Grob

4. Mapping Mammalian 3D Genomes by Micro-C

Elena Slobodyanyuk, Claudia Cattoglio, and Tsung-Han S. Hsieh

Part II: Targeted Hi-C Approaches

5. Targeted Chromosome Conformation Capture (HiCap)

Artemy Zhigulev and Pelin Sahlén

6. Assessment of Higher-Order, Multi-Way Interactions with Tri-C

A. Marieke Oudelaar, Damien J. Downes, and Jim R. Hughes

7. Assessing Specific Networks of Chromatin Interactions with HiChIP

Dafne Campigli Di Giammartino, Alexander Polyzos, and Effie Apostolou

Part III: Sequencing-Based Approaches to Assess Nuclear Environment

8. Measuring Cytological Proximity of Chromosomal Loci to Defined Nuclear Compartments with TSA-Seq

Liguo Zhang, Yu Chen, and Andrew S. Belmont

9. The High-Salt Recovered Sequence-Sequencing (HRS-seq) Method: Exploring Genome Association with Nuclear Bodies

Cosette Rebouissou, Marie-Odile Baudement, and Thierry Forné

Part IV: Single-Cell Approaches

10. High-Throughput Preparation of Improved Single-Cell Hi-C Libraries Using an Automated Liquid Handling System

Wing Leung and Takashi Nagano

11. Simultaneous Quantification of Spatial Genome Positioning and Transcriptomics in Single Cells with scDam&T-Seq

Silke J.A. Lochs and Jop Kind

Part V: Visualizing Spatial Genome Organization

12. High-Throughput DNA FISH (hiFISH)

Elizabeth Finn, Tom Misteli, and Gianluca Pegoraro

13. Versatile CRISPR-Based Method for Site-Specific Insertion of Repeat Arrays to Visualize Chromatin Loci in Living Cells

Thomas Sabate, Christophe Zimmer, and Edouard Bertrand

Part VI: Functionally Dissecting Chromatin Architecture

14. CLOuD9: CRISPR-Cas9-Mediated Technique for Reversible Manipulation of Chromatin Architecture

Wei Qiang Seow, Poonam Agarwal, and Kevin C. Wang

15. Acute Protein Depletion Strategies to Functionally Dissect the 3D Genome

Michela Maresca, Ning Qing Liu, and Elzo de Wit
